Abstract

Iron deficiency anemia is a major public health issue in South Konawe Regency. This condition is characterized by low hemoglobin levels in the blood, primarily caused by insufficient iron intake. Based on examinations, 144 adolescents were diagnosed with mild anemia, while two cases involved severe anemia. Common symptoms reported include fatigue, dizziness, and difficulty concentrating, all linked to low hemoglobin levels. The data for this study were collected through interviews and document analysis. The findings indicate that the primary causes of anemia among adolescents in Andoolo Utama include poor dietary habits, a lack of awareness about the importance of balanced nutrition, and practices such as frequently skipping breakfast. To prevent anemia, routine educational sessions on healthy eating habits are conducted in schools, along with providing information to parents to ensure their children consume iron-rich foods such as red meat, liver, and green vegetables. Additionally, the distribution of iron supplementation tablets (TTD) to adolescent girls is considered essential to improve hemoglobin levels, which often decrease due to menstruation.
